President Donald Trump has announced that he believes the United States and Ukraine are close to finalizing a minerals deal that will be mutually beneficial for both nations.

As reported by The New Arab, Trump made the announcement at the White House while signing an executive order aimed at increasing domestic critical mineral production.

“We’re also signing agreements in various locations to unlock rare earths and minerals” he stated. He further elaborated that negotiations with Ukraine were progressing well, adding that a deal would be signed “shortly”

If finalised, the minerals deal would provide significant economic benefits for both the US and Ukraine by unlocking new opportunities.

For Ukraine, developing its mineral resources could play crucial role in post-war economic recovery, with these resources potentially becoming the cornerstone of the country’s economy.

On the other hand, for the US, access to Ukraine’s minerals is seen as a means for Kyiv to repay Washington for its continued support in the war against Russia. Trump and many of his allies have advocated for this approach, arguing that Ukraine should compensate the US for military and financial aid.

Previous attempts to negotiate the deal have failed due to diplomatic differences and a public falling-out between Trump and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ky on February 28th.

The potential agreement comes against the backdrop of ongoing ceasefire negotiations between Ukraine and Russia, mediated by the US.

It is hoped that a ceasefire will eventually lead to a broader peace deal, helping to stabilize the war-torn region. Commenting on the progress, President Trump said that peace negotiations were “going pretty well” fuelling optimism that an agreement  could be reached soon.
